Jacqui Heinrich Grills Bernie Moreno on Trump's Tesla Promo
Briefly

In a Fox News Sunday interview, Jacqui Heinrich confronted Republican Senator Bernie Moreno regarding President Trump's promotional event featuring Teslas on the White House lawn. The event coincided with economic troubles for many Americans, particularly related to their 401k accounts. Heinrich questioned whether it was appropriate for the president to use the White House as a backdrop for a car promotion. Moreno defended Trump, arguing the importance of promoting American-made products, while also critiquing Democrats' anti-EV stance. Trump, responding to similar critiques, maintained that Americans would thrive despite economic uncertainties, echoing a message of optimism.
